Understanding⁣ Airline Carry-On Policies for Sports Equipment

When it comes to traveling with sports equipment like ⁤a ‍pickleball paddle,⁢ understanding ‍the various airline carry-on policies is crucial. Each airline has distinct ⁤regulations​ that dictate⁣ what ⁣can be⁢ brought on board,​ and ⁢these rules can differ based on ⁣the ‍type⁤ of aircraft and specific ⁣routes. Carry-on restrictions often include size and ⁣weight limits,which‌ can ​pose challenges for sports enthusiasts looking to ‍bring their gear along. For anyone planning‌ to fly with ⁢a ⁤pickleball paddle, it⁣ is‍ indeed​ advisable⁢ to ⁣check​ the airline’s official website or contact customer ⁣service for precise data.

in general, ‍most airlines⁢ allow sports equipment in​ carry-on bags‍ as‍ long⁣ as it measures within the ⁤specified ⁤dimensions. Typically, pickleball ⁢paddles, ‍being relatively lightweight and streamlined, can ⁢fit⁢ into ‌the carry-on categories. However, some airlines may classify​ paddles as oversized or special items,​ which ​might affect their eligibility for ‍carry-on status. ⁢It’s crucial‍ to be prepared, so⁤ consider‌ these options when ⁢planning your trip:

  • Check dimensions: verify ​that your paddle fits within the airline’s‌ carry-on size limits.
  • Protect your gear: use protective padding or ‍a case to prevent damage during travel.
  • Arrive early: allow extra time at security checks ⁢to avoid complications.

To aid ⁤travelers, some airlines do provide ⁤specific ⁤criteria regarding sports equipment. Here’s a brief look at typical⁢ airline policies ⁤relevant to carrying a pickleball paddle:

Airline Carry-On Size Limit Sports Equipment policy
Delta Airlines 22 x 14 ⁢x ⁢9​ inches Allowed​ if it fits, otherwise may require gate check.
American airlines 22‌ x 14 x 9 inches Must be packed securely and comply with size⁣ restrictions.
Southwest‌ Airlines 24 ⁤x 16 x 10 inches permitted⁣ aboard as part of carry-on⁢ allowance.

The ​Dimensions That Matter: Choosing the Right Paddle⁤ for‌ Travel

When selecting‌ a paddle for your travels,size‍ and weight take precedence. Lightweight paddles, typically made from composite materials or⁢ advanced⁣ polymers, are ideal for⁢ travelers‌ who‌ prioritize portability ⁢without sacrificing performance. ​Look for paddles ‌within the ⁢typical dimensions of‌ 15.5 to 16 inches ⁣in length ‍and 7.5 to‌ 8.5 inches in⁣ width. These specifications facilitate easy packing without‍ impinging ‌on​ your carry-on‌ baggage limits.

Another crucial ​factor is the ‍ grip ‍size. An appropriate⁣ grip size not only ensures comfort during extended play but ‌also‌ affects your ability to⁢ navigate through ⁤travel ‍and tournaments. Generally,‌ grip sizes range from 4 inches‍ to 4.5 inches in circumference. When selecting your paddle, consider opting for a smaller ​grip for easier⁤ maneuverability, especially if you’re ⁣traversing⁤ crowded travel spaces.

assess the paddle’s durability. A robust⁣ paddle should withstand ‍the rigors of travel, including potential bumps⁤ and drops during​ transit.⁣ When ⁢evaluating ⁢materials,look for⁤ paddles ⁢with a‍ strong ⁣polymer core and a resilient face. Here’s a rapid⁢ comparison​ to​ consider:

Material Weight Durability
Composite Lightweight High
Wood Medium Medium
Graphite Lightweight Very High

Q&A: Can you Carry On a Pickleball Paddle?

Q1: Is it allowed ⁣to bring​ a pickleball paddle as a carry-on‍ item when flying?
A1: ​Yes, ⁣you can ‌typically carry ⁢a pickleball ‌paddle in your carry-on luggage.Most‍ airlines permit⁤ sporting equipment as long as it fits within the airline’s size​ restrictions. It’s always best to‌ check with your specific airline for any unique regulations.


Q2: Are there⁤ any size restrictions for a pickleball ‌paddle​ as carry-on luggage?
A2: While ⁣airlines generally⁣ have a standard size ⁢limit for​ carry-on items—most commonly ‌around 22 x 14 x 9 inches—pickleball ‍paddles usually meet these⁢ guidelines.Just ensure​ your ​paddle fits comfortably with any other ‍items you plan to carry onboard.


Q3: What should I⁢ do ‌to prepare my⁣ pickleball paddle for travel?
A3: To protect your paddle,​ consider ⁣using⁣ a ‌paddle cover or⁢ a padded‌ bag. This will help ‌prevent damage⁢ from knocks or bumps during the journey. Additionally,it’s wise⁢ to pack ⁤your paddle in an easily accessible part ​of your ​carry-on,as⁣ security might request‌ you to show ​it.


Q4: Are there any⁢ additional regulations I should be aware of?
A4: ⁣besides size,⁣ you should also be mindful of the airline’s policies regarding sports equipment. Certain items might potentially be subjected to extra‍ scrutiny during security ⁣checks. Consequently,keeping ​your ⁢paddle​ in an accessible pocket can expedite this process.
